Output 6455408f80b86e407402de5d2a2a023d6bfb51f496b67e15d6c7c04930b6f828:0

value
42124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b356d524c770298df72f6e19fa9abe67b84f16fa OP_EQUAL
address
3J3Gu7fScmJ9xvc8G2heCX8TTnmNoVjZSn
transaction
6455408f80b86e407402de5d2a2a023d6bfb51f496b67e15d6c7c04930b6f828
confirmations
278038
spent
true